Working as an Hourly Speech-Language Pathologist in Beavercreek
When considering part-time opportunities in Beavercreek, a speech-language pathologist working 24 hours a week could expect to take home just over $60,000 annually, a significant difference compared to full-time wages. Per diem and agency work is particularly lucrative, with some SLPs billed as high as $75 per hour in school settings and even more in medical contexts, where dysphagia specialists can command rates of $80 to $110. Payment structures often vary by employer type; SLPs in school districts may earn lower hourly rates but benefit from health insurance packages, while private practice and teletherapy positions might offer flexible hours and higher pay rates without benefits. Understanding these dynamics is essential for negotiating effective compensation in Beavercreek, as some practitioners opt for lower hourly rates in exchange for stability and benefits.
